Output 3d59eb5d8e88bbe1ff0e4d5c25e5e4c62b3915207cc29b2cabe1c4821ea01b7b:8

value
43870338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68975e3a193dcdb2070cbe647f6feb48f8ceb520 OP_EQUAL
address
3BE3XjReBWKE9uyBd3JAwYci6jQmALsYK9
transaction
3d59eb5d8e88bbe1ff0e4d5c25e5e4c62b3915207cc29b2cabe1c4821ea01b7b
spent
true